EphB1 protein is a receptor tyrosine kinase that participates in bidirectional signaling with ephrin B ligands (including EFNB1, EFNB2, and EFNB3). It plays a crucial role in retinal axon guidance, neural progenitor cell regulation, dendritic spine maturation, synapse formation, angiogenesis, targeted cell migration, and muscle stem cell maintenance. EphB1 Protein, Mouse (sf9, His-GST) is the recombinant mouse-derived EphB1 protein, expressed by Sf9 insect cells , with N-His, N-GST labeled tag. The total length of EphB1 Protein, Mouse (sf9, His-GST) is 394 a.a., with molecular weight of ~60 kDa.

Background

EphB1 protein is a receptor tyrosine kinase that binds to ephrin-B ligands on neighboring cells, resulting in contact-dependent bidirectional signaling. This receptor mediates both forward signaling and reverse signaling pathways. Its ligands include EFNB1, EFNB2, and EFNB3, which play important roles in various cellular processes. During nervous system development, EphB1 regulates retinal axon guidance and interacts with EFNB2. In the adult nervous system, it works together with EFNB3 to regulate chemotaxis, proliferation, and polarity of neural progenitors. EphB1 is also involved in dendritic spine maturation, synapse formation, angiogenesis, targeted cell migration, and adhesion. Activation by EFNB1 and other ephrin-B ligands activates MAPK/ERK and JNK signaling pathways, which regulate cell migration and adhesion. Additionally, EphB1 is important for maintaining the pool of muscle stem cells (satellite cells) by promoting self-renewal and reducing activation and differentiation.
